Abstract

We demonstrate nanoscale magnetic imaging with sub-20 nm spatial resolution using high-harmonic radiation. This first demonstration will allow for comprehensive studies of ultrafast spin dynamics with nanometer spatial and femtosecond temporal resolution using a lab-scale source.
